Peaks Mt. Isolation, NH
Trails
Trails: Rocky Branch Trail, bushwhack, Isolation Trail, bushwhack, Davis Path, Isolation Spur
Date of Hike
Date of Hike: Sunday, February 20, 2022
Parking/Access Road Notes
Parking/Access Road Notes: Cars parallel parked at 8:45am. 3/4 full at 2:30pm on return. 
Surface Conditions
Surface Conditions: Snow/Ice - Frozen Granular, Snow/Ice - Postholes 
Recommended Equipment
Recommended Equipment: Snowshoes, Light Traction 
Water Crossing Notes
Water Crossing Notes: Easily crossed, for now

Comments: Previous reports today are spot on, so won’t go into detail on the bushwhack fiasco. Following the correct line would save 2 miles from the summer route. Microspikes at start, changed to snowshoes while on the EBH until summit, switched back to micros until finding the correct EHB line and then switched back to snowshoes. Once back on Rocky Branch, I barebooted without micros the whole way back, what a treat that was!
